we are using BQ51050BRHL to charge a small battery that requires only 35 mA fast charge current.

Adjusting the various component the BQ51050BRHL works fine.

For most of the time, the system powered by the battery drows only 4 uA, consequentely any additional current should possibly be avoided.

However, when the receiver coil is not on the transmitter coil (no wireless power present), we found that the BQ51050BRHL drows around 170 uA.

Is this wright? or this current should be maximum 20 uA as indicated in the data sheets 8.5 Iq?

What should be the state of the various control pin in order to minimize this current?

  • Are you testing on our EVM? I have verified the on our EVM that quiescent current at the BAT when the wireless power is disabled is around 12uA.

    Is 4 uA your calulated current draw by the system? or is it tested when wireless power is presented?

    Please see bq51050B EVMuser's guide to see the configuration that I verified on the bench. 

  • Also, BQ51050B charging current spec between 500mA to 1500A. It is not recommended to use bq51050B for 35mA fast charge applicaitons. Please take a look at bq51003 + bq25100 combination. This combo will provide much acurate termination with low current charging batteries. The IQ should also be lower.
